As promised, a bit of Monster Track 8-ness.

I blackmailed Ms. Erin Nicole Brown to get her to procure something about last weekends Monster Track 8 held in New York City. Shes came through with not only a blurb, but some pics as well.

'On February 17, 2007, held the 8th annual Monster Track in New York City.  This is a track bike only alleycat race with NO BRAKES.  The race started at Sara D. Roosevelt Park.  Despite the snow on the ground and the cold weather people came from all over.  Alfred from NYC took first place male (third time winner) and Heidi, also NYC took first place woman.  There was a guy riding a penny-farthing during the whole race!  It was amazing.  Thanks to Victor, sponsors, and many others in NYC for making this, another memorable event.'
